Artist In FOCUS

● KATIE PINK ●

Katie Pink is an emerging artist born in 1979 in Aotearoa, New Zealand, moved to Australia in 2005, and now lives on Bundjalung Country, Northern New South Wales.

She completed the three-year course at Byron School of Art in 2024 and is currently engaged in their alumni program.

Winner of Northern Rivers Community Gallery Graduation Prize. Her solo exhibition will be held there in October 2025.

In this series of works, Katie constructs her paintings on board using polyurethane, adding acrylic paint and pigment, blending them like a tasty cake icing. She lets layers appear and blend into a single form. Katie's paintings examine the tension between softness and hardness, showcasing pink tones alongside blacks and the warmth of golds.

WORKSHOP: “The Art Of Listening” - Interactive Workshop


Drawing and mark-making are not only the very first forms of ‘recording’ for humanity, but are at the foundation of any art or creative practice, regardless of the medium or discipline. However, these practices and processes rely purely on the eye (observation), brain and hand connection.  There are other ways of utilising drawing and the capacity to think at a deeper level, simply by including our ears and the process of listening.  

The method I employ uses drawing and or mark-making in response to compositions and audio-delivered text.   These methods have been scientifically proven to allow different parts of the brain to be ‘switched on’ and stimulated, taking the intuitive thinking process to new and deeper levels. It requires no skill at all.  The focus is on mark-making, gesturing, recording, and not finished works.

Since our move into the bigger, brighter space on Acacia Street in Byron Bay’s buzzing Arts & Industrial Estate, Pack Gallery Studio has been humming. The walls have held more than just art, they’ve echoed with words, breath, and music.

We’ve transformed into a unique event space, and the response has been incredible. From M.E. Baird’s thought-provoking lectures (yep, all sold out) to Breathwork Sessions that quite literally took the room’s breath away, the studio has become a place for connection, curiosity, and creative pause.

And of course, the art keeps flowing with new artists and fresh works continuing to inspire and surprise. The walls shift, the energy evolves, and each month feels like a new chapter.
